Utah.Gov Receives Grade A Rating in Digital States Survey
07 November 2018 - 4:47PM
Business Wire
Builds on a Tradition of Innovation and
Excellence
Utah.Gov, the official website of the State of Utah, received a
grade A rating from the Center for Digital Government in the 2018
Digital States survey. The biennial survey is the industry’s
leading evaluation of the technology practices of all 50 states.
The survey highlights the best and emerging technology practices
that serve as models for providing online services for state
residents.
“This is the most exhaustive evaluation of digital services
provided across the country," said Michael Hussey, Utah Chief
Information Officer. "The survey validates Utah’s use of technology
to improve service delivery, increase capacity, streamline
operations and reach policy goals.”
States that receive a Grade A rating are ahead of other states
in the innovative use of technology solutions. Grade A states’
online solutions show results across all survey categories and are
used to realize operational efficiencies and strategic priorities
through meaningful collaboration across state agencies. Only four
states were given an A grade this year. Utah has received an A
grade every year since the survey started giving out grades in
2010.
“Utah was recognized for its leadership in creating a platform
for serving Utah residents,” said David Fletcher, Utah Chief
Technology Officer. “Our approach allows Utah to expand the gap
ahead of other states while providing useful online services.”
The Center for Digital Government is a national research and
advisory institute on information technology policies and best
practices in state and local government.

About Utah.Gov
Utah.Gov is the entry point to over 1,000 online services and
benefits over 2.7 million residents in the state of Utah. Utah.Gov
provides citizens and businesses with more convenient options for
interacting with government. Through Utah.Gov, citizens can find
public meetings, renew their vehicle registration, buy a hunting
and fishing license, register a business, find a transparent state
budget, and much more. In 2015 alone, Utah.Gov received 21 awards
making it the nation’s most honored state website. Utah.Gov is
managed and operated through a public-private partnership between
the state and Utah Interactive, the Salt Lake City-based official
digital government partner for the state of Utah. Utah Interactive
is part of firm NIC’s family of companies.
